14 June Amnesty International Vigil calling for a Safe Route for refugees at the Greek Embassy London! Amnesty called a vigil to mark the tragic sinking of the Adriana boat which sank close to the Greek island Pylos. 750 plus refugees were aboard the boat tragically only 104 were rescued …

16 May 2024 demonstration in front of the Home Office organised by IFIR, IOIR and Labour campaign for free movement. Supported by Jeremy Corbyn and John McDonnell Labour MP’s, Afghan Association, AWL, PCS union of the civil service, KMEWO, MEWSO and FIR.
